This happened last season and I didnāt discover it until April last year. The coolant wa comment from the fitting on the recovery bottle. And I tightened the clamps. I was down last weekend and some coolant leaked again. I pulled the hose and shined a bright light on the hose. Found some small cracks in the hose. Hose is cheap. Replace them and the clamps. Thatās what Iām going to do.
